Subject: [PATCH 2/3] packagegroups: Disable unbuildable dependencies for riscv64
Date: Sun, 15 Jul 2018 12:44:03 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20180715194404.29736-2-raj.khem@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20180715194404.29736-1-raj.khem@gmail.com>

This helps with cleaner world build parsing logs

Signed-off-by: Khem Raj <raj.khem@gmail.com>
---
 .../pack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-profile.bb           | 3 +++
 .../pack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-testapps.bb          | 1 +
 me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-go-sdk-target.bb  | 2 ++
 3 files chang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-profile.bb b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-profile.bb
index 5d2b4c8181..520d907714 100644
--- a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-profile.bb
+++ b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-profile.bb
@@ -33,6 +33,7 @@ PERF_libc-musl = ""
 SYSTEMTAP = "systemtap"
 SYSTEMTAP_libc-musl = ""
 SYSTEMTAP_nios2 = ""
+SYSTEMTAP_riscv64 = ""
 
 # lttng-ust uses sched_getcpu() which is not there on for some platforms.
 LTTNGUST = "lttng-ust"
@@ -44,6 +45,7 @@ LTTNGTOOLS_libc-musl = ""
 LTTNGTOOLS_riscv64 = ""
 
 LTTNGMODULES = "lttng-modules"
+LTTNGMODULES_riscv64 = ""
 
 BABELTRACE = "babeltrace"
 
@@ -58,6 +60,7 @@ VALGRIND_armv5 = ""
 VALGRIND_armv6 = ""
 VALGRIND_armeb = ""
 VALGRIND_aarch64 = ""
+VALGRIND_riscv64 = ""
 VALGRIND_linux-gnux32 = ""
 
 RDEPENDS_${PN} = "\
diff --git a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-testapps.bb b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-testapps.bb
index df43068fe5..a35f15e6ce 100644
--- a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-testapps.bb
+++ b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-core-tools-testapps.bb
@@ -15,6 +15,7 @@ KEXECTOOLS ?= "kexec"
 KEXECTOOLS_e5500-64b ?= ""
 KEXECTOOLS_microblaze ?= ""
 KEXECTOOLS_nios2 ?= ""
+KEXECTOOLS_riscv64 ?= ""
 
 X11GLTOOLS = "\
     mesa-demos \
diff --git a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-go-sdk-target.bb b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-go-sdk-target.bb
index 7d2ccbda22..5afb490aac 100644
--- a/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-go-sdk-target.bb
+++ b/meta/recipes-core/packagegroups/packagegroup-go-sdk-target.bb
@@ -7,3 +7,5 @@ RDEPENDS_${PN} = " \
     go-runtime-dev \
     go-runtime-staticdev \
 "
+
+COMPATIBLE_HOST = "^(?!riscv64).*"
